Career path

Career Role Description
VR Software Engineer (Connected Vehicles) Develops and maintains software for virtual reality applications in the connected vehicle industry, focusing on immersive driver training and vehicle design. Requires expertise in VR development frameworks and automotive systems.
VR/AR UX Designer (Automotive) Creates user interfaces and experiences for virtual and augmented reality applications within the automotive sector, ensuring intuitive and engaging interactions with connected vehicle features. Focus on user-centered design principles.
Virtual Reality Simulation Engineer (Autonomous Vehicles) Designs and implements virtual reality simulations for testing and training autonomous vehicle systems, encompassing sensor data integration and realistic environment modeling. Strong programming and simulation skills are essential.
Connected Vehicle Data Analyst (VR Focus) Analyzes data from connected vehicles using VR visualization techniques to identify trends, improve performance, and create predictive models. Proficient in data analysis and visualization tools, including VR applications.
